A protest outside the Constitutional Court in November 2024 when lawyers for Blind SA requested that a court-crafted copyright exception for braille and other accessible formats be extended.

Read groundup.org.za/article/all-... by Christo de Klerk
All they ask is access to books: SA is failing the blind
South Africa has still not ratified the Marrakesh Treaty it adopted in 2013

Ever since I learned about this study enrolling I have been eagerly awaiting the results. Researchers in Uganda took a centuries-old cultural practice mothers carrying babies on their backs in cloth wraps and turned it into a public health tool. You got to love it!
www.nejm.org/doi/full/10....
Permethrin-Treated Baby Wraps for the Prevention of Malaria | NEJM
Malaria remains a major cause of childhood death in sub-Saharan Africa. We leveraged the traditional practice of mothers carrying children on their backs in cloth wraps to assess whether treating t...

#Accessibility When you use hashtags use Pascal Case so a screen reader can read the words correctly, so use #EasyRead not #easyread
